Zebron ZB-BAC-2 GC Columns

Fast, Accurate Blood Alcohol Analysis

  • Proprietary column set specially designed for accurate blood alcohol analysis — enhance resolution of ethanol and acetone peaks
  • Resolves t-butanol and n-propanol for greater selection of internal standards
  • Fast run time with baseline resolution of key components in just 2 minutes
  • Achieve dual column confirmation - get two elution order changes with ZB-BAC-1

Faster, More Sensitive Blood Alcohol Analysis

Column:
As listed
Dimension:
As listed
Part No.:

7HK-G021-36 (ZB-BAC-1)

7HK-G022-32 (ZB-BAC-2)

Injection:
Split 0.8:1 @ 150 °C, 1 mL
Carrier Gas:
Helium @ 80 cm/sec (constant flow)
Oven Program:
40 °C (Isothermal)
Detector:
FID @ 250 °C

Sample:

Analytes 0.025 % and internal standards
0.100 % in water
1. Methanol
2. Acetaldehyde
3. Ethanol
4. Isopropanol
5. Acetone
6. t-Butanol (IS)
7. n-Propanol (IS)
8. 2-Butanol (IS)

In contrast, the Phenomenex Zebron ZB-BAC-1 & and ZB-BAC-2 columns were able to fully resolve both t-Butanol and 2-Butanol from other target analytes, while maintaining rapid analysis times. Quantitative analysis on the Zebron BAC pair showed equivalent performance between all three internal standards (n-Propanol, t-Butanol, and 2-Butanol). The LOD & and LOQ for this column set were far below the control limits required by current testing regulations.

Estimated Limits of Detection (LOD) and Quantitation (LOQ) on Zebron ZB-BAC1 and ZB-BAC2 phases. The LODs and LOQs are also displayed in units of ppm in addition to % blood alcohol content.

Compound
Zebron ZB-BAC1
Zebron ZB-BAC2
LOD
LOQ
LOD
LOQ
Methanol
0.0003 %
(2.9 ppm)
0.001 %
(9.7 ppm)
0.0003 %
(3.0 ppm)
0.001 %
(10.1 ppm)
Acetaldehyde
0.00002 %
(0.2 ppm)
0.00008 %
(0.8 ppm)
0.00002 %
(0.2 ppm)
0.00006 %
(0.6 ppm)
Ethanol
0.0003 %
(2.6 ppm)
0.0009 %
(8.8 ppm)
0.0002 %
(2.2 ppm)
0.0007 %
(7.4 ppm)
Isopropanol
0.0002 %
(1.8 ppm)
0.0006 %
(5.8 ppm)
0.0001 %
(1.4 ppm)
0.0005 %
(4.6 ppm)
Acetone
0.00008 %
(0.8 ppm)
0.0003 %
(2.6 ppm)
0.00005 %
(0.5 ppm)
0.0002 %
(1.7 ppm)

High reproducibility of Zebron ZB-BAC1 and ZB-BAC2 for blood alcohols. Relative RSD values for replicate injections (n=5) were taken at the lowest concentration in the calibration curve of 0.025 %.
